The subclass 457 temporary skilled migration visa scheme should be toughened to eliminate abuses, including by a new complaints mechanism and reviews of training compliance and the adequacy of Regional Certifying Bodies, according to the unanimous recommendations of a Federal Parliamentary inquiry released today.
